I am trying to find a way to create a workbook with many
worksheets for our employees. I would like to limit
access for each worksheet by password and only allow them
to see that worksheet, hide all the others.
 
Hi Sheila!

Before we start on a solution, it's crucial to ask what will be the
impact if another employee gets to see someone else's sheet?

The reason why this is important is that protection in Excel is not
very secure. Programs and techniques are freely available for
circumventing the different password processes used by Excel.

A better approach might be separate workbooks for separate employees
with a master file that you can use to extract the data you need. That
involves a "physical" approach to security that is more likely to be
successful.
